Israeli University Professor: Rape Palestinian Sisters and Mothers To Stop Terrorism

Israel-Palestine1

As bombs rain down upon Gaza and Israeli troops march forward with tanks and bulldozers, a recent radio interview conducted on Israeli radio is drawing some criticism from across the world as well as in Israel.

Although the interview was conducted nearly three weeks ago, shortly
after the bodies of three Israeli teens were found after being kidnapped
and murdered, Dr. Mordechai Kedar stated that the only way to force
“terrorists” to think twice about their actions is the threat of the
rape of their sisters and mothers.
A Middle East scholar from Bar-Ilan University in Israel, Dr. Kedar
stated that “You have to understand the culture in which we live. The
only thing that deters [Hamas leaders] is a threat to the connection
between their heads and their shoulders.”
Hakol Diburim (It’s All Talk) host Yossi Hadar then asked if that
consideration “could filter down” the ranks of Hamas, Kedar responded
“No, because lower down the considerations are entirely different.
Terrorists like those who kidnapped the children and killed them – the
only thing that deters them is if they know that their sister or their
mother will be raped in the event that they are caught. What can you do,
that’s the culture in which we live.”
Hadar attempted to rein Kedar’s statement’s back somewhat by saying
that “We can’t take such steps, of course….” However, Kedar reiterated
his own statement by responding that “I’m not talking about what we
should or shouldn’t do. I’m talking about the facts. The only thing that
deters a suicide bomber is the knowledge that if he pulls the trigger
or blows himself up, his sister will be raped. That’s all. That’s the
only thing that will bring him back home, in order to preserve his
sister’s honor.”
Amidst the controversy, Bar-Ilan has attempted, albeit poorly, to downplay the statements made by Kedar. As Haaretz reports,

Kedar chose not to be interviewed. A joint response with
spokeswomen from Bar Ilan stated that he “did not call and is not
calling to fight terror except by legal and moral means.” It also said
Kedar “wanted to illustrate that there is no means of deterring suicide
bombers, and using hyperbole, he gave the rape of women as an example.
In order to remove all doubt: Dr. Kedar’s words do not, God forbid,
contain a recommendation to commit such despicable acts. The intention
was to describe the culture of death of the terror organizations. Dr.
Kedar was describing the bitter reality of the Middle East and the
inability of a modern and liberal law-abiding country to fight against
the terror of suicide bombers.”

As a result, feminist activists have sent a letter to the president
of Bar-Ilan University Rabbi Prof. Daniel Hershkowitz in complaint. The
letter states opposition to Kedar’s “words of incitement that grant
legitimacy to Israel Defense Forces soldiers and Israeli civilians to
commit rape, and endanger both Israeli and Palestinian women. Kedar’s
words echo expressions that treat rape as a remedial practice, although
it is a war crime.”
It is important to mention that Kedar is a research fellow at the
Begin-Sadat Center for Strategic Studies at Bar-Ilan. He also served as
Chairman of the Israel Academia Monitor organization, a group that is
actively involved in “exposing extremist Israeli academics who exploit
academic freedom in order to take steps to deny Israel’s right to exist
as a Jewish state.” In other words, Kedar is a chief witch hunter of
